Central Freight Lines is the largest trucking company to close since Celadon ceased operations in 2019. Waco, Texas-based Central Freight Lines has notified drivers, employees and customers that the less-than-truckload carrier plans to wind down operations on Monday after 96 years, the company’s president told FreightWaves on Saturday.Web

EPA to propose sweeping new truck emissions regs. (Photo: Jim Allen/FreightWaves) Listen to this article. 5 min. The Biden administration will soon propose a regulation aimed at cutting nitrogen oxide (NOx) emissions from heavy-duty trucks. Container imports bound for the U.S. have dropped over 36% since May 24. (This index measures departing container volumes at the port of origin). The seasonally adjusted inventory-to-sales ratio in January was 2.95. Excluding the spike in 2020 during COVID lockdowns (when sales crashed, temporarily inflating the ratio), the January number was close to the recent high of 3.1 the month before. If you have a privacy related issue, please email us directly at privacy ... Ontario looking to extend the fuel tax rate cut to Q2 2024. Since July 1, 2022, Ontario has lowered the gasoline tax by 5.7 cents per liter and the fuel tax by 5.3 cents per liter. Time is running short for a handshake agreement to avert a nationwide Teamsters union strike against UPS Inc. threatened for Aug. 1. Talks broke off July 5 and will resume next week. Shippers that haven’t made contingencies could be up against the wall.
